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en St. Petersburg

Cuál es el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más barato en St. Petersburg?

Actualmente el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más accequible en St. Petersburg está en Jefferson Manor listado en $700.

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en St. Petersburg?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en St. Petersburg es $2,081.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en St. Petersburg?

A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en St. Petersburg una unidad de 3,950 a partir de $2,650 en Back Bay at Carillon.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en St. Petersburg?

El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en St. Petersburg es actualmente de 675 sq ft.
